Abstract

The construction site of Masjed Soleyman Dam is of considerable importance due to the presence of impermeable clay layers and the conditions for the formation of suspended water aquifers. First, engineering geological studies of the site including office studies, field visits, discontinuities, detailed studies were performed, then using UDEC software, stability analysis and groundwater flow modeling were performed and the results obtained from numerical modeling were in good agreement with the reading. Stretching devices that confirm the accuracy and validity of numerical modeling. According to the results of numerical modeling, the hydrogeological conditions of the site have formed suspended aquifers within the conglomerate and sandstone layers, the lower boundary of which is impermeable clay layers. Because the slope of the stratification is oblique and its direction is inward, the water does not drain easily. Increase in volume), produce and increase pressure on the retaining walls and eventually cause it to crack and fall. In these cases, the use of vertical gravity drains at the top of the slope with greater depth so that it has cut all impermeable layers (clay) and the use of horizontal gravity drains at the bottom of the slope with longer length can reach at least up to the layering boundary to stabilize the structure.
